Chicken Fajitas

Serves: 4
Prep time: 15 minutes + 30 minutes marinating time
Cook time: 15 minutes

1 ½ serves per portion

Recipe courtesy of the Country Kitchens team

Ingredients:
  • 3 tablespoons olive oil
  • 2 garlic cloves, minced or 1 teaspoon garlic powder
  • 2 teaspoons ground cumin
  • 1 teaspoon ground chilli powder
  • 1 teaspoon paprika
  • ½ teaspoon dried oregano
  • Salt and pepper to taste
  • Juice of one lime
  • 500g skinless chicken thighs, fat trimmed, sliced into 1cm strips
  • 3 large capsicums (different colours), deseeded and sliced
  • 1 large onion, sliced into half-moons
  • 1 large avocado, sliced
  • Fresh coriander, leaves only, to serve
  • 8-12 small flour or corn tortillas
Method:
  1. COMBINE 2 tablespoons oil, garlic, cumin, chilli, paprika, oregano, salt and pepper and lime juice in a shallow bowl.
  2. ADD chicken strips and mix to coat. Marinate for at least 30 minutes. Drain well.
  3. HEAT a large pan over medium high heat. Add remaining oil.
  4. ADD chicken strips to frying pan and cook through, approximately 5 minutes, stirring occasionally.
  5. REMOVE chicken and transfer to a plate. Loosely cover with foil.
  6. USING the same pan with the chicken cooking juices retained, add the capsicums and onion and cook until soft, about 5-10 minutes.
  7. ADD chicken back to pan and cook for further 1-2 minutes or until warmed through.
  8. SERVE the chicken mix, sliced avocado, coriander and warmed tortillas on a platter so that everyone can build their own tortilla with their desired toppings.
What's Great About It:

These fresh and colourful fajitas come together in just 30 minutes making them a great dinner option for those busy weeknights! They have an awesome flavour hit from the delicious marinade and can be served with a selection of your favourite toppings e.g. light sour cream, guacamole instead of avocado, salsa or refried beans. Perfect for a tasty Mexican fiesta with friends, or as simple meal prep for the work week.
